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$897 per month in Pingtung city vs $1,188 in Setagaya-ku, rent included.

A couple spends around $1,476 per month in Pingtung city vs $1,879 in Setagaya-ku, rent included.

A family of three spends $2,054 per month in Pingtung city vs $2,569 in Setagaya-ku, rent included.

Pingtung city is about 24% cheaper than Setagaya-ku, driven mainly by Getting Around.

Both Pingtung city and Setagaya-ku are more affordable than the global median – Pingtung city 34% lower, Setagaya-ku 13% lower.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$247 in Pingtung city versus $510 in Setagaya-ku.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 29% higher in Pingtung city, which reinforces the cost advantage – you earn more and spend less. Purchasing power leans clearly in its favor.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$32.00 in Pingtung city versus $26.00 in Setagaya-ku.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$338 vs $295 – making Setagaya-ku the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
